A Seat in the Spotlight: The Life and Times of a Movie Critic
Life for a movie critic isn't always glamorous. Sure, there are exclusive premieres, but the real work happens behind the scenes. Critics analyze themselves in the world of cinema, deconstructing every frame and scene. It's a demanding profession that requires a keen eye for detail and the ability to convey thoughts in a clear and concise manner. A critic must be able to enthrall audiences with their writing, while simultaneously upholding the highest standards of cinematic excellence.
Still, the rewards can be great. A well-written review can influence a film's success, and critics often have a platform to discuss the important social and cultural issues that films touch upon. At its core, being a movie critic is about more than just rating films. It's about appreciating the power of cinema to move us.
